HUNTERSVILLE – The Planning Board on Tuesday deferred until Dec. 16 a request for rezoning and sketch plan approval from Epcon Communities.

The Dublin, Ohio-based company asked for the deferral until it can work out issues raised at the town Board of Commissioners meeting earlier this month, including clarification of an easement on Kinnamon Road, a private gravel road that several other properties access, and details on the company’s tree save plans and buffers.

The planning staff recommended that the rezoning not be approved unless those and other issues are worked out.

The proposed development, Courtyards at Kinnamon, would include 94-units of age-restricted homes on 29.6 acres between McCoy Road and The Park – Huntersville office and industrial development just west of Interstate 77. The company is asking that the zoning be changed from conditional district neighborhood residential from neighborhood residential.
